If you are investigating the file , it is likely related to CVE-2023-23376 , a high-severity elevation of privilege vulnerability in the Windows Common Log File System (CLFS) Driver. This specific vulnerability has been actively exploited in the wild to allow attackers to execute code with SYSTEM privileges.
